How do I choose the right ceramic coated water bottle for my needs?
Start with your intended use and pick a ceramic coated water bottle that fits that activity. Look for a food-grade ceramic coating, BPA-free materials, and a durable lid to prevent leaks during workouts or daily commuting. Consider capacity (1.0–1.5 L is common for gym or all-day use) and ease of cleaning, plus a finish that resists staining and odors. Finally, check the brand’s care guidelines to keep the coating intact over time.
What is the most important detail about the coating on a ceramic coated water bottle and why does it matter?
The coating’s safety and durability matter most because it directly contacts your beverage. A high-quality, food-grade glaze creates a non-porous surface that resists staining and odors and remains intact with regular hand washing. Adequate adhesion and thickness prevent chipping during daily use and drops, preserving taste and safety. Always verify that the bottle is marketed as ceramic coated and that the coating is certified for beverage contact.

What maintenance steps keep my ceramic coated water bottle in top condition and ensure compatibility with other beverages?
Hand wash with warm water and mild soap after each use, avoiding abrasive scrubbers that can scratch the coating. Rinse well and air-dry with the lid off to prevent odor buildup. Do not place ceramic coated bottles in the dishwasher unless the manufacturer explicitly allows it. If you use hot liquids, confirm the bottle’s heat rating from the brand and avoid sudden temperature changes that could damage the glaze.
